MTV EMAs 2023 cancelled due to Israel-Hamas conflict

Posted: 1 month ago • By: rantplay badge

The MTV Europe Music Awards (EMA) 2023, which were scheduled to take place in Paris on November 5, 2023, have been cancelled due to the ongoing conflict between Israel and Hamas.

MTV announced the cancellation of the awards in a statement on October 19, 2023. The statement said that the decision was made “out of an abundance of caution for the safety of the performers, crew, and attendees.”

The statement also said that the MTV EMAs are “an annual celebration of global music,” and that “this is not a moment for a global celebration.”
